Output 59cd7af9b3cad06b6718582fc29082a7b1f605e4a89b1ae840b045b8316f2f93:1

value
23863323
script pubkey
OP_HASH160 OP_PUSHBYTES_20 181b54d9c9ec788214c5e0f835e9734ea7347809 OP_EQUAL
address
MA6dC4E5wxrUaZgaHhbHXaw6RXChc669hr
transaction
59cd7af9b3cad06b6718582fc29082a7b1f605e4a89b1ae840b045b8316f2f93
spent
true